跟大家講解下有關ASP.NET是什么,有什么優點?,相信小伙伴們對這個話題應該也很關注吧,現在就為小伙伴們說說ASP.NET是什么,有什么優點?,小編也收集到了有關ASP.NET是什么,有什么優點?的相關資料,希望大家看到了會喜歡。
ASP.NET是一個開源的服務器端web應用程序框架,它可以快速的構建網站而且所需配置少,在編譯的過程中還提供了所有代碼一致的驗證從而使其易于識別和修復等等.NET是一個微軟的技術平臺,主要用于快速開發和跨平臺操作。我們可以使用它去開發C/S結構的軟件或者是開發B/S結構的網站。而ASP.NET就是.net框架中的一部分,接下來在文章中將為大家具體介紹有關ASP.net的有關知識,具有一定的參考價值,希望對大家有所幫助。
【推薦課程:ASP.NET教程】
ASP.NET的含義
ASP.NET是一個開源的服務器端Web應用程序框架,由Microsoft在Windows上運行,它允許開發人員創建Web應用程序,Web服務和動態內容驅動的網站。
ASP.NET的優點
ASP.NET由于它的高速,低成本以及廣泛的語言支持而廣泛的應用于網站開發及應用程序中。同時它擁有許多優點而受到開發人員的喜愛。如以下幾點
(1)ASP.NET由于它內置與Windows服務器環境中,所以相比較其他web開發平臺而言,它需要的設置和配置更少。
(2)使用ASP.NET構建的網站比使用PHP構建的網站更快更高效。編譯ASP.net應用程序會節省很多時間,因為編譯后將由.Net平臺反復執行。
(3)在編譯過程中還提供了所有代碼一致的驗證。例如將名為GetUser的方法重命名為GetEmployee作為某些代碼更新的一部分,則在整個應用程序的其余部分對GetUser的任何引用都將在編譯期間導致錯誤,從而使其易于識別和修復。
(4)ASP.NET代碼可以使用簡單的文本編輯器來編寫代碼,比如常見的Visual Studio應用程序這是一款輕量級的編輯器每個人都可以使用這樣節省了很多軟件開發成本。
(5)在開發Web應用程序時,使用什么類型的數據庫是一個重要的決定。ASP.NET應用程序可以使用所有流行的數據庫,包括Microsoft SQL Server,MySQL等等
(6)ASP.NET是使用面向對象編程語言,而且ASP.NET是開源的并且可以免費使用。
ASP.NET主要包含的內容ASP.NET主要包括WebForm和WebService兩種編程模型。前者為用戶提供建立功能強大,外觀豐富的基于表單(Form)的可編程 Web頁面。后者通過對HTTP,XML,SOAP,WSDL等Internet標準的支持提供在異構網絡環境下獲取遠程服務,連接遠程設備,交互遠程應用的編程界面.
總結:以上就是本篇文章的全部內容了,希望對大家有所幫助。
以上就是ASP.NET是什么,有什么優點?的詳細內容,更多請關注php中文網其它相關文章!
來源:php中文網